The Childrens Institute Foundation
The Childrens Institute Foundation reported paying Wendy Pardee, President & Ceo, $23,175 in total compensation (FY 2023).
That places Wendy Pardee at approximately the 12th percentile among 168 similarly sized philanthropy & grantmaking nonprofits (median $90,888).
